It <em>joins your team<\/em>: a smart colleague that helps you make faster, fairer, and more informed decisions.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"ember2178\">The rules aren\u2019t here to stop you \u2014 they help you trust AI<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2179\">The GDPR and the EU AI Act aren\u2019t designed to block innovation. They exist to <strong>create clarity and confidence<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2180\">Together, they define how AI can be used responsibly in recruitment, selection, and talent development: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ul>\n<li><strong>GDPR<\/strong> governs how personal data is processed \u2014 what happens <em>with<\/em> the data.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>The AI Act<\/strong> defines how AI systems must behave \u2014 what happens <em>inside<\/em> the technology.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2182\">In short: GDPR protects people, the AI Act regulates machines.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2183\"><strong>And that difference matters in practice.<\/strong> Because while the laws may sound abstract, they directly shape how we build and train AI systems in HR. Take the use of data, for example. Even if something looks public \u2014 like a LinkedIn profile \u2014 it\u2019s not automatically free to use. Only when people <em>know<\/em> what their data is used for, it\u2019s compliant.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2184\">That\u2019s why leading HR tech companies, like <strong>8vance<\/strong>, work exclusively with <strong>anonymised and synthetic data<\/strong> \u2014 patterns, not persons. Start here: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2192\"><strong>1. Build awareness.<\/strong> Talk about what AI already does in your HR processes. Often, it\u2019s more than you think.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2193\"><strong>2. Run a mini-DPIA.<\/strong> A Data Protection Impact Assessment helps you map risks and show you\u2019re in control.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2194\"><strong>3. Work with anonymised or synthetic data.<\/strong> You\u2019ll learn patterns without touching personal data.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2195\"><strong>4. Check for bias.<\/strong> AI can support objectivity, but it needs human reflection.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2196\"><strong>5. Keep the human in charge.<\/strong> Think of AI as your co-pilot, not your replacement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2197\"><strong>6. Document and learn.<\/strong> Record what you do \u2014 not for bureaucracy, but to learn what truly works.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"ember2198\">The real promise of AI in HR<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p id=\"ember2199\">AI can make HR more efficient <em>and<\/em> more inclusive.
